Will stood near the airport gate. Leo had left Grace and Will
alone and had already boarded the plane.
"So you're really gonna do this, huh?"
Grace hesitantly smiled. "Yeah. Yeah, I'm definitely going to do this. Leo
is my husband, I've got to go with him."
Will pouted but tried not to show it. "Your call. I'm going to miss my best
friend though."
"It's only for eight months, Will," Grace reminded him.
Will nodded. "I know,"
"If it's any consolation, I'm going to miss you more." She said quietly.
"Now lets get this done with before I start to cry."
Will smiled, and kissed Grace on the lips. "Bye sweetie," he said. "Call
and write lots."
She smiled. "Love ya."
"You too."
Grace picked up her bags and started to walk down the corridor to the
airplane. She stopped, dropped her bags, and ran to give Will one last hug.
He hugged her back tightly, not wanting to let his best friend go.
"You're going to miss your plane." He said, smiling a bit.
"Just wanted to give you one last hug," Grace replied.
"Go," Will replied softly. "I'll see you in eight months."
She smiled and headed down the corridor again, this time not stopping or
looking back.
"Goodbye Gracie," Will said.
